BOURBONNAIS – Three men are in custody following a string of motor vehicle burglaries across the area.

Over the weekend Police arrested 30-year-old Phil G Hayes Jr of Chicago, 18-year-old Jaylin T James of Bourbonnais, and 39-year old Dimitri Lurman after an extensive investigation into a string of motor vehicle burglaries in the area.

Haynes was booked into the Jerome Combs Detention Center in Kankakee Saturday on multiple warrant charges along with unlawful possession of a debit/credit card and residential burglary charges.  His bond was set at $200,000.

James was booked into the Jerome Combs Detention Center in Kankakee Saturday on a warrant charge.  His bond was set at $75,000.

Details on Lurman’s arrest have not yet been made available.
